Aditivos Mucogénicos para el Control de Caligus rogercresseyi en Salmón del Atlántico (Salmo salar)

Abstract: El mucus es uno de los componentes más importantes de la inmunidad del pescado, contiene componentes de la inmunidad innata como glicoproteínas, lisozima, proteínas del complemento, enzimas proteolíticas, péptidos antimicrobianos e inmunoglobulinas. Se revisa información actualizada concerniente a la generación, fisiología y efectos del mucus en el salmón del Atlántico, así como de posibles aditivos mucogénicos para el control de parásitos que puedan ser atractivos para ser utilizados a futuro en la disminució… Show more
